The Structure of a Family Office

Typically, a family office can be structured in various forms, chief among them being single-family offices and multi-family offices. A single-family office serves just one family, tailoring every aspect of its services to meet their unique needs. Conversely, a multi-family office manages the affairs of several families, offering a pool of resources and shared costs to achieve a more economical operation.

The Importance of Asset Allocation

Asset allocation remains a cornerstone of any family office investment strategy. It involves distributing investments across multiple asset classes to manage risk and align with the family’s long-term objectives. For instance, younger families may allocate a higher percentage of their portfolio to equities, capitalizing on higher growth potential, while older generations might prioritize fixed income or income-generating investments to ensure stability during retirement.

How to Initiate a Money Transfer

The first step in sending money through Western Union is to find a nearby agent location or visit their official website. At an agent location, you will need to fill out a form with the recipient’s details and the total amount to be sent. Online transfers, meanwhile, require an account and provide the ease of transferring money from home. Furthermore, irrespective of the service channel you choose, understanding the process of how to send money through Western Union is crucial to ensuring your money reaches its destination safely.

The Process: Step-by-Step

Once you have filled out the transfer form or completed the transaction online, you will receive a unique Money Transfer Control Number (MTCN). Share this code with your recipient, as it is crucial for them to collect the money. Transfers typically reach their destination within minutes, although it can vary based on the country and the receiving institution’s policies.

Safety and Fees

Western Union provides multiple layers of security for its transactions. It’s important to keep all receipts and MTCN information secure, and only share them with the intended recipient. Fees can vary based on the service chosen, the amount sent, and the destination country. It is advisable to compare rates and choose the most cost-effective option for your needs.

The Evolution of Wireless Security Protocols: WPA3 vs. WPA2

Wireless access points have become an indispensable part of contemporary networking solutions, providing seamless connectivity across various devices. However, as technology progresses, so do the strategies devised by cybercriminals to breach network security. Over the years, Wi-Fi security protocols have evolved to enhance protection against unauthorized access, with WPA3 being the latest iteration in this evolution.

WPA2, or Wi-Fi Protected Access 2, was introduced to replace its predecessor, WPA, offering stronger data encryption methods and improved security features. It became the standard for securing Wi-Fi networks for over a decade. Nevertheless, as advances were made in computational power and hacking techniques, WPA2’s vulnerabilities were increasingly exploited, necessitating the development of a more robust solution.

Enter WPA3. Unveiled with the promise of bolstering network safety, this protocol brought significant enhancements. One notable improvement is the implementation of individualized data encryption, which secures connections between personal devices and the router. Furthermore, WPA3 introduces Simultaneous Authentication of Equals (SAE), a secure handshake protocol that effectively mitigates the risk of offline dictionary attacks commonly associated with WPA2.
